C-shaped (most common), helical (for higher sensitivity), and spiral (for very low pressures) configurations, each offering different displacement characteristics for specific pressure ranges.
Temperature changes cause thermal expansion/contraction of tube material, affecting elasticity and zero point. Compensation methods include bi-metal strips, liquid-filled cases, or temperature-corrected materials.
Oxygen (requires degreased components), chlorine, ammonia, and other reactive chemicals may require special materials like Monel or stainless steel with appropriate passivation.
